Mary E. Triggiano was a judge for the Milwaukee County Circuit Court, Branch 13, Wisconsin.[1] She was first appointed to the position in 2004 by then Gov. Jim Doyle.[2] Triggiano is also the Presiding Judge of the Domestic Violence Court.[2]

Triggiano won re-election without opposition in the general election on April 4, 2017.

Education

Triggiano earned her B.S. from the University of Wisconsin-Oshkosh in 1984 and later her J.D. from the University of Wisconsin Law School in 1988.[2]

Career

  • 2004-2023: Presiding Judge, Domestic Violence Court
  • 2004-2023: Judge, Milwaukee County Circuit Court
  • 1996-2004: Managing Attorney, Legal Action of Wisconsin
  • 1994-2004: Director, Volunteer Lawyers Project
  • 1988-1994: Attorney, Private Practice[2]

Elections

2017

See also: Wisconsin local trial court judicial elections, 2017

Wisconsin held local judicial elections in 2017. Forty-eight circuit court seats were up for election on April 4, 2017. Three seats required primaries on February 21, 2017, with the top two vote recipients for each seat advancing to the April 4 general election. Thirty-seven seats up for election in 2017 were unopposed.[4] Incumbent Mary Triggiano ran unopposed in the general election for the Branch 13 seat on the Milwaukee County Circuit Court.

2011

See also: Wisconsin judicial elections, 2011

Triggiano was re-elected after running unopposed on April 5, 2011.[5][6]
